On March 18, 2024, the Catholic Herald Institute presented its Inaugural symposium entitled, “THE ROOM WHERE IT HAPPENED, Unwrapping the Synod and Exploring What is Next”. 

The event was held at the Archbishop Fulton Sheen Center for Thought and Culture in lower Manhattan.  The symposium, the first in the Institute’s “Conversations in the Spirit”, was moderated by Michael La Civita, Director of Communications for the Catholic Near East Welfare Association (CNEWA) and Lieutenant of the Eastern Lieutenancy of the Equestrian Order of Holy Sepulchre of Jerusalem.  Speakers included Argentine journalist and member of the Synod’s Communications Team, Inés San Martin, Fr. Ricardo da Silva, SJ, and the Institute’s chair, Amanda Bowman.
